Under which Article of the Constitution can an individual move to the Supreme Court directly in case of any violation of Fundamental Rights? |
A. | Article 32 |
B. | Article 28 |
C. | Article 29 |
D. | Article 31 |
Answer» A. Article 32 | |
Explanation: Right to constitutional remedies under Article 32 of the Indian Constitution empowers the citizens to move a court of law in case of any denial of the fundamental rights. The courts can issue various kinds of writs such as habeas corpus, mandamus, prohibition, quo warranto and certiorari. |
